National Post Takes a Summer Vacation
Starting today the National Post is only publishing a digital version of its newspapers on Mondays. The paper said it will resume printing the Monday paper after Labour Day.
Canwest is trying to save money by not publishing a Monday print edition of the paper but they’re going to have to get a little more creative to avoid bankruptcy. TechCrunch has some ideas on How To Save The Newspapers but unless the economy picks up steam really soon, the National Post and a number of other newspapers could soon disappear.
